Furthermore, the community has led the shift toward gender-affirming language in mainstream society. The widespread introduction of sharing pronouns (he/him, she/her, they/them), the use of honorifics like "Mx.", and the adoption of gender-neutral terms like "sibling" or "folks" stem directly from transgender advocacy for validation and visibility. The modern LGBTQ+ rights movement was largely built on the courage of transgender and gender-nonconforming individuals. For decades, marginalized communities found strength in numbers, standing together against systemic oppression.
LGBTQ culture, at its core, is not a monolith about sex or gender; it is a culture of the other . It is a set of traditions, languages, and social norms built by people who were told their natural way of loving or existing was wrong. Because transgender people reject the gender binary assigned at birth, and LGB people often reject the sexual binary of heterosexuality, their lived experiences of stigma, family rejection, and legal discrimination produce a shared cultural consciousness.

The demand from the trans community is for material change: healthcare access, protection from violence, economic justice, and the end of the homelessness crisis that disproportionately affects trans youth. LGBTQ+ culture’s energy is being channeled from celebration into direct action and mutual aid—a return to the grassroots, Stonewall-era spirit.
For LGBTQ+ culture to be genuinely inclusive, it must actively center and protect its transgender members. True solidarity involves moving beyond passive acceptance into active allyship. This means supporting trans-led organizations, defending access to healthcare, and listening to trans voices when shaping policies and cultural narratives. The history of the queer community proves that progress is only achieved when everyone moves forward together.

Transgender individuals frequently face targeted legislation regarding access to gender-affirming healthcare, restrictions on updating legal documents, and bans from participating in sports categories aligned with their gender identity.

Transgender identity is about gender identity (who you are). LGB identity is about sexual orientation (who you love). They are different axes of identity. A trans woman who loves men is heterosexual. A trans man who loves men is gay.
